55 ft deep?? Can you show us some cat pics of these fish you been catching? Only time I fish that stretch is in January after we’ve had a big cold snap. When I lived on Lewisville, the summer heat created a dead zone. I never fished below 25 feet. Here on the Tn River I had to re-educate myself. This weekend I was fishing holes 50 -70 feet deep.

Got out and fished Saturday and Sunday morning...Started out saturday spinning my wheels. Graph wouldn’t power up at the ramp but was able get it going after switching the cables to different battery. Got halfway across the lake and realized I left my new net in the truck. First hour of fishing burned up in smoke. Once I got going bait was easy in 32 ft. Started out drifting the main lake humps and landed 5 eaters first drift. Fish started to move off structure pretty early so I went and checked several other areas close by but nada. Moved back to the humps around 9:30 and everything had moved out into open water. Fish were in 30 ft suspended 10ft off the bottom so I moved up the lake into the Little Elm branch and looked for fish in 20 ft. Found a real good group on Whitehouse Hump and drifted through em. Caught 10 more eaters on the last drift and saved the day. Got off the water at 10:45 when the jet skis started circling like sharks. We also fished for a few hours Sunday and did about the same. Cool thing happened while deploying a planer board. While letting line out on a planer I noticed the line started moving sideways fast. I flipped the clutch as line was peeling and the rod doubled over with a hookup and boom 16 lbr! This time of year there is only a short window of time to catch fish in the morning and if you waste any time then you’ll burn up half the good fishing. I had a few issues to iron out but it was good to be back on the water and knock the rust off.
